Smooth ceilings: Due to the factory finish of gypsum drywall panels and the conventional methods of concealing joints and fasteners with the products available today, certain conditions may detract from the quality of the “smooth” finish of the ceilings. Even though the gypsum drywall panel surface is meticulously treated and as smooth as possible, conditions involving a combination of lighting (both natural and electrical) and gloss-enamel or high-gloss paint may bring about shadows which accentuate even the slightest surface variation across the face of the panel. These surface variations in colour and sheen may affect the quality of the finished product and in all likelihood will be most visible where there are treated joints, fastener heads, or corner beads. To eliminate the problems noted above, the recommended installation is that your ceiling surfaces be finished with a machine-applied medium to heavy texture spray.
  10. Stained stairs: The hardwood flooring to be installed on the Property is factory finished through an automated process, whereas the stained Staircase will be finished manually on-site. As well, the materials used by the contractors assembling the Staircase do not use material from the same suppliers and as such, the stain will not be absorbed in the same fashion for each piece of oak. Accordingly, on-site finishing of the Staircase will result in variations in colour, sheen and consistency of finish and, as such, the Staircase and the hardwood flooring will differ in appearance.
  11. Hardwood floors: Purchaser(s) are advised that the normal installation practice, as recommended by the hardwood manufacturer, is to install the hardwood perpendicular to the floor joists. Since not all floor joists run in the same direction throughout the home, the Purchaser(s) acknowledge and accept that the hardwood will not all run in one direction but will be installed as per the hardwood manufacturer’s recommendation. The Purchaser accepts this method of installation.
